    supply source for miltary kilt refurbishing?

    Does anyone know of a source for buying the kind of green woolen twill tape/ribbon that is used as a top band on old military kilts?
    Also, are 2 pronged buckles still being produced? Would straps to fit them have to be custom made?

    A couple of questions:
    Is green the color that is always/usually used as the binding/top band for military kilts?
    Is black or navy or forest green ever used?
    I'm guessing that 1 1/2" wide would be the best, as compared with 7/8" or less. Yes?
    Does the twill have to be wool or is cotton okay?

    A few years ago, I used green grosgrain ribbon because I couldn't find a source for green wool twill tape. I know it's not proper or correct, but it worked.

    I seem to recall seeing officers kilts having a regular tartan band, which wouldnt be a surprise if they had to buy their own... Conversely other ranks kilts likely get recycled altered and repaired... The tape probably makes/made repairs easier...

    Wasnt there someone who popped up on here saying they were a military tailor last year?

    I dont think that green is the only colour now...
